Selecting the right luxury island destination begins with a clear sense of your preferred pace, privacy, and culinary standard. Seek properties that pair intimate villa layouts with attentive but unobtrusive service staff, ensuring that every moment feels exclusive rather than isolated. A strong emphasis on in-house gastronomy can elevate a stay, particularly when private chefs design menus around your tastes, dietary needs, and seasonal ingredients sourced from nearby producers. Equally important is the ability to customize excursions—from sunrise mangrove kayak trips to private reef snorkels or cultural tours that connect with local artisans. Look for operators who partner with small, family-run farms and community initiatives to ensure sustainability across food, travel, and lodging.
The right itinerary harmonizes indulgence with responsibility. Ask potential hosts how they integrate environmental best practices into daily operations: energy efficiency, water conservation, waste reduction, and responsible wildlife interactions. A genuine luxury experience should feel effortless while minimizing footprints; for example, solar power, advanced filtration, and low-emission transport options can be commonplace rather than exceptional. Favor islands that maintain transparent supply chains, disclose local sourcing percentages, and provide guests with options to offset travel emissions. In addition, choose experiences that respect local culture—guide-led storytelling, traditional music sessions, or handicraft demonstrations that place respect for heritage at the center of your vacation.

A truly idyllic getaway begins with a capable planning team that translates your preferences into a seamless calendar. Expect dedicated concierges who can arrange everything from intimate in-villa tasting menus to discreet, health-conscious spa rituals. Look for private chefs who collaborate with local farmers and fishermen, ensuring menus rotate with the seasons and reflect regional flavors. The best programs also allow guests to participate in sustainable activities—such as reef restoration workshops or culinary classes that reuse leftovers creatively—so indulgence includes education and stewardship. A thoughtful itinerary minimizes crowds while maximizing authentic encounters with the island’s soul and rhythms.

When choosing tailored excursions, prioritize depth over breadth. Private yacht charters, eco-friendly snorkel excursions, and guided hikes should be framed by expert local guides who can interpret ecosystems without disturbing wildlife. Seek itineraries that include cultural briefings before visits to villages or sacred sites, enabling respectful engagement and proper dress, behavior, and etiquette. A robust luxury package blends relaxation with discovery: sunset sails coupled with chef-curated tastings, spa experiences that reflect local botanicals, and photography sessions that capture memories without disrupting fragile habitats. In every activity, seek transparency about environmental safeguards and cultural sensitivities.
Experiences chosen with care for earth heritage and community
The essence of a luxury island stay often rests on a chef-led dining philosophy that celebrates terroir while accommodating dietary needs. Envision menus that evolve with island harvests, featuring reef-safe seafood, heirloom vegetables, and aromatic herbs grown on-site or sourced from nearby farms. Your private chef should be able to design multi-course tastings that reveal regional storytelling through flavor, texture, and technique. Pair meals with regional wines or zero-proof options crafted to highlight local botanicals. Beyond meals, culinary experiences can include market tours, foraging walks, and chef’s table evenings that illuminate the methodology behind each dish—always with an emphasis on waste minimization and responsible sourcing.

Equally central is the capacity to tailor wellness and recreation to your body’s rhythms. Consider private fitness schedules, personalized wellness assessments, and mindful movement sessions conducted in serene outdoor spaces. Wellness programs should align with sustainable practices—eco-friendly mats, locally scented aromatics, and spa rituals using plant-based, ethically sourced ingredients. For families or multi-generational groups, the itinerary can incorporate child-friendly workshops and cultural exchanges that teach respect for local traditions while keeping activities engaging. A standout property provides guests with choices that honor privacy and personal pace, ensuring a restorative escape that doesn’t demand a single moment of compromise.

The perfect island retreat seamlessly combines privacy with meaningful interactions. Look for accommodations that offer discreetly tucked suites, private pools, and outdoor living spaces designed to minimize energy use while maximizing comfort. A strong sustainability framework should include measurable targets—recycling programs, composting, and energy dashboards visible to guests—so you can observe progress during your stay. Community engagement is equally vital: partnerships with schools, preservation projects, and support for local artists help travelers contribute positively. Transparent reporting about conservation initiatives, visitor impact, and cultural preservation gives you confidence that your luxury experience supports the long-term vitality of the place you’re visiting.
In practice, sustainable luxury means choosing operators who actively rehabilitate natural habitats rather than merely avoiding harm. This can be evident in reef-safe diving protocols, coral planting days, or mangrove restoration activities open to guests. It also includes modest infrastructure—smart climate controls, efficient insulation, and locally crafted furniture that reduces transport emissions. When evaluating options, request data on energy consumption per guest and water-use efficiency benchmarks. Front-of-house staff trained in environmental ethics can also enhance your stay by guiding you through responsible choices around waste, single-use plastics, and respectful entrenchment in the island’s daily life.

A genuinely luxurious escape enlists partners who share a commitment to integrity and long-term stewardship. Research the property’s affiliations with conservation groups, blue-flag beaches, or ecotourism certifications that attest to reputable practices. Ask how local communities benefit from guest presence—through fair wages, training programs, or investment in public services. Transparent contracts with suppliers that emphasize fair pricing and sustainable materials help ensure your trip leaves a positive imprint. Your conversations with hotel managers or island operators should reveal how itineraries are designed to minimize seasonality pressures and respect local rhythms, from fishing calendars to religious observances.
Beyond the obvious luxuries, attention to detail matters deeply. Quietly appointed rooms with natural light, breathable fabrics, and low-emission amenities create a serene atmosphere that complements the island’s climate. Thoughtful touches such as refillable toiletry containers, seasonal décor, and locally crafted artwork reinforce a sense of place while reducing waste. Curated experiences should avoid overcrowded hotspots, offering instead intimate settings that allow quiet immersion in landscape, soundscapes, and the cadence of daily life. When a guest is truly integrated into the locale, small acts of sustainability become second nature, enhancing both comfort and conscience.
Determining value in a luxury island escape involves more than price; it requires assessing outcomes for people and ecosystems. Seek clarity on what portion of your expenditure supports conservation, education, or cultural preservation. A well-structured program will provide guest-authored footprints—an estimate of carbon emissions, water saved, and waste diverted—paired with a plan for ongoing improvements. You should also encounter opportunities to reinvest in the community after departure, such as follow-up communications about restoration progress or invitations to participate in future projects. Ultimately, the most redeeming trips leave you with gratitude, new knowledge, and a commitment to lighter travel.
When planning, document your priorities and ask for a pre-arrival brief that outlines every operational detail—from excursion timings to chef rotations and conservation commitments. A credible luxury operator will welcome you to review safety guidelines, environmental policies, and cultural norms before you arrive. In addition, verify cancellation policies that reflect fluctuating conservation project schedules and weather conditions. The right choice is the one that delivers seamless indulgence while empowering you to contribute positively. With careful research and thoughtful dialogue, an idyllic island getaway becomes a template for sustainable, culturally respectful travel that enriches both guest and host communities.
